Château Mont-Pérat produces white wines from Bordeaux, drawing on the region's tradition of elegant, mineral-driven blends. The winery's portfolio centers on Sémillon and Sauvignon Blanc—grapes that thrive in Bordeaux's maritime climate and gravelly soils. Parcelle B227 Bordeaux, a Sémillon and Sauvignon Blanc blend, stands as the flagship, followed by a pure Sémillon expression in Bordeaux Blanc. Les Amants de Mont-Pérat rounds the range with Muscadelle and Sauvignon Blanc. All three wines have been assessed by major critics including Wine Enthusiast, Wine Advocate, Decanter, and Wine Spectator, reflecting their place within serious Bordeaux white production. The winery's focus on white varietals positions it within a smaller but distinguished segment of the appellation, where precision and terroir expression define the category.
